Backflow testing services involve inspecting and assessing a building’s backflow prevention devices to ensure they are functioning correctly. These devices are designed to prevent contaminated water from flowing backward into the clean water supply, which can pose health and safety risks. During testing, professionals evaluate the integrity and operation of backflow preventers, identifying any issues that could compromise water quality. Regular testing helps maintain compliance with local regulations and ensures that the water supply remains safe for residential, commercial, or industrial use.
The primary purpose of backflow testing is to identify potential problems before they lead to more significant issues such as water contamination or system failure. A malfunctioning backflow preventer can allow pollutants, bacteria, or chemicals to enter the potable water system, increasing health hazards for occupants or users of the property. Testing services help detect leaks, blockages, or faulty components that could impair the device’s ability to prevent backflow.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ent costly repairs, water damage, or health-related complications.

Cost Range - Backflow testing services typically cost between $75 and $200 per test, depending on the property size and location. For example, a standard residential test may be around $100, while larger commercial properties could be higher.
Factors Affecting Price - Costs may vary based on system complexity, accessibility, and local service rates. Additional repairs or certifications might incur extra charges beyond the initial testing fee.
Average Service Fees - The average fee for backflow testing in Westlake Village, CA, is approximately $125. Prices in nearby areas may range from $80 to $180 for similar services.

What is backflow testing? Backflow testing is an inspection of a building's backflow prevention device to ensure it is functioning properly and preventing contaminated water from entering the public water supply.
How often should backflow testing be performed? Typically, backflow prevention devices should be tested annually to maintain proper operation and compliance with local regulations.
Who provides backflow testing services? Local plumbing or backflow specialists offer backflow testing services to evaluate and maintain backflow prevention devices.
Why is backflow testing important? Regular testing helps prevent potential contamination of drinking water and ensures the backflow prevention device is working correctly.
